Quantum Algorithms for Optimization
Quantum algorithms for optimization harness the power of quantum mechanics to solve complex optimization problems beyond the capabilities of classical computers. These algorithms explore novel approaches like quantum annealing and variational quantum eigensolvers, tackling challenges in areas such as logistics, finance, and materials science.
